WebThe small shelter system tent can withstand steady wind loads of 50 knots How many types of liners does the small shelter system tent use Three The environmental control unit should be approximately how many inches away from the small shelter system tent end wall 12 Inspect the small shelter system tent electrical cable assemblies every 30 days
